Whirring Speedo?

Recommended Posts

ginge191

As titled; i'm getting a pretty awful whirring noise coming from behind my speedo.

 

It does NOT make the noise once i've picked up a certain temperature/been running the car for a while, but can often start again once i start moving after being on standstill for a while.

 

It gets louder as i drive faster and sends the reading on the dash mad (i hit 120mph+ apparently the other day)

 

Any ideas??

Yes, yes it is! Well the obvious answer would be to replace the cable, its cheap and easy to do. Is the noise coming from directly behind the gauges? It could be the speedo drive on the gearbox playing up but wouldn't make the sound you describe.

Remove the dash top cover , remove the instrument cluster and use some MoS2 based spray and spray down the speedo cable , or can add some engine oil with a syringe ... after that use a tiny brush and stuff some lithium grease on the end of the speedo trying to push the grease as far as you can down the cable ..

 

That should quiet it down B) .. at least it did on mine , quick and easy repair .
